Even if the Conservatives do get into power, dont expect this to actually happen. If i remember right, they have promised this sort of thing before but it never happens due to pressure from tree-hugging hippies and road safety campaigners.
Lets face it, 90% of the prats on the motorways are so unobservant they arent really safe even at 70, never mind any faster.
What I would rather see is conpulory re-testing for ALL drivers every 5 years, making motorway driving part of the driving test, traffic police doing something usefull like clamping down on middle-lane hogs and some kind of grading system for speeeding offences. If i do 38 outside a school at 4 oclock i get 3 points and £60 fine. if I do 90 on a deserted motorway at 11pm, i get 3 points and a £60 fine. Which is more dangerous?
